Description

The FT8330 series battery simulator is a high precision, multi-channel, single quadrant programmable battery analog power supply.Single device channels is up to 36 and each channel is electrically isolated, it is convenient for users to connect series and parallel power supplies. The ultra-high output accuracy, as well as the characteristics of ultra-low ripple and interference, make this series of power supplies widely used in testing systems such as battery cells, super capacitors, and BMS.

The FT8330 series adopts a standard 19 inch chassis and provides Ethernet port and RS485 communication interface, which is convenient for integration into research and development and production line automation testing platforms, and can also be used separately.

Ultra high integration

FT8330 series adopts standard 19 inch and two chassis specifications. Single 2U chassis can accommodate up to 24CH, and a 3U chassis can accommodate 36CH. The channels are isolated from each other. One device can test 36 work stations at most at the same time, which can effectively reduce the number of devices used by users and improve the test efficiency.

 

Ultra high accuracy

FT8330 series has high accuracy, voltage accuracy is 0.01%+0.01% F.S. Voltage resolution is as low as 0.1mV, current resolution is as low as 0.1 μA. For the test of device power consumption in standby mode, the FT8330 has 0.1μA current resolution measurement,can easily measure the standby current of μA level.

 

Serial connection between channels

FT8330 electrical isolation between each channel. When it is necessary to simulate multiple strings of battery cells, the simulator can support any multi-channel in series, or multiple battery cell simulators in series. Users can also perform remote control and other automatic test applications through remote interfaces.
